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from Kyoto city center, take the Meishin Expressway towards Osaka. Follow the signs for Osaka, and then take the exit towards Nakanoshima. Once you exit, continue on Nakanoshima Street until you reach the Osaka City Central Public Hall located at 1 Chome-1-27 Nakanoshima, Kita Ward. There is parking available nearby, but be aware that it can fill up quickly during peak hours.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Osaka City Central Public Hall via public transportation, take the JR Tokaido Line from Kyoto Station to Osaka Station. From Osaka Station, transfer to the Osaka Metro Yotsubashi Line. Take the subway towards Nishi-Nakajima-Minami and get off at Yodoyabashi Station. Exit the station and walk for about 10 minutes towards Nakanoshima. You will see the hall on your left at 1 Chome-1-27 Nakanoshima.

  • Public Transportation

    Alternatively, you can take the Hankyu Kyoto Line from Kyoto Station to Umeda Station. From Umeda, transfer to the Osaka Metro Midosuji Line and ride towards Nakamozu. Get off at Yodoyabashi Station and exit toward Nakanoshima. Walk approximately 10 minutes to the Osaka City Central Public Hall. Make sure to look for signs pointing towards Nakanoshima as you walk.

Discover more about Osaka City Central Public Hall

Osaka City Central Public Hall is a magnificent architectural landmark located in the heart of Osaka, Japan. This historic venue, with its stunning Neo-Renaissance design, offers a glimpse into the city's rich cultural heritage. Built in the early 20th century, it has become a central hub for community events, conferences, and live performances. Visitors are welcomed into a grand atrium adorned with intricate details, making it a perfect spot for photography enthusiasts. The hall often hosts a variety of cultural events, including concerts, art exhibitions, and public gatherings, showcasing the talents of both local and international artists. Its prime location on Nakanoshima Island provides a scenic backdrop, especially during the evening when the building is beautifully illuminated, creating a magical atmosphere perfect for a leisurely stroll. The surrounding park adds to the charm, inviting tourists to relax and soak in the vibrant spirit of Osaka.
